Aside from a select few metropolitan areas, Craigslist maintains standard time limits for ads posted in... Major Cities. Craiglist imposes stricter time limits on ads posted in large metropolitan cities and other highly... Paid Job Postings. All ...• Refresh ads regularly: Craigslist ads will stay live for between 7 and 45 days, depending on the area in which they are posted, but Craigslist now allows you to renew the post from your account page 48 hours after it’s posted. This will return the ad to the top of the local Craigslist. The Planned PostThis behavior by Craigslist is completely undocumented so avoiding or working around it can be challenging. Unlike your vacation rental website or other listings on OTAs, your Craigslist ads will need renewing and reposting frequently if you want them to stay active. In some of the major cities, Craigslist classified ads will expire after seven days, but in the majority of other cities you have up to 45 days ...

Staying true to its simple nature, Craigslist doesn't have an auto-renew feature that would keep your company's ads ongoing on the site. This craigslist training secret will g...Craigslist allows you to move free ads by renewing them, although you can only renew an ad every 48 hours. For paid ads, you must pay another fee to get the ads moved to the top. By David Wayne Updated April 06, 2018 When you post ads on Craigslist from an account, your ads are stored on your account page as long as your account is active. You can look up active or expired ads by signing in to your account and searching the chronological list of ads.Paid posting account features: Tools for managing paid postings ( list of paid posting types/areas ). Multiple authorized users can be set up on a single account. Pre-purchase blocks of postings —avoid entering credit card information for each posting. Invoicing (requires $2000 minimum purchase within last 3 months). Additionally, you can choose to delete your postings at any time before the 45-day period expires if you no longer need them.According to Craigslist, you can bump your ad up to once every 48 hours. However, note that there are some restrictions on this matter. If your ad appears in multiple categories, then you can only bump every 48 hours from the time you posted it in the first category.
